With this position we offer:The opportunity to join the development organization for Nasdaq SMARTS. Our SMARTS Surveillance technology powers surveillance and compliance for over 40 marketplaces, 11 regulators and 100 market participants across 65 markets globally. Scalable to millions of transactions and flexible to manage various unique data sources, SMARTS Surveillance holistically examines scenarios across multiple venues and asset classes. We are currently seeking a Senior Manager with previous experience in managing teams and back-end java development to manage and build the Connectors team in Bangalore. The team works closely with Product, Operations as well as the sister Connectors team in Sydney to maintain and enhance the NTS data collection and conversion infrastructure. The teams are responsible for all the major software components required to collect and convert the data streams, which are the lifeblood of the NTS customer offering.In addition to the ongoing maintenance, upgrades and enhancements to continuously support our existing NTS customers, the team provides the functionality to support new markets, new data streams, new customer subscriptions and new initiatives (e.g. Tier 3 customers, expanding Crypto offering, AWS Cloud migration).
